Festive message from Dick and Janet!

05 Dec 08

Please find below a festive message from Dick and Janet Collins.

"Another Year has come and gone, and what a year this has been – starting in April and still continuing with 2 small shows in December, but as many of you know, whilst working at the Red Bull Flutag in Hyde Park, Dick received a bump on the back of the head which resulted in him having 2 strokes. The first one caused him to lose quite a lot of vision which we did not realise was a stroke. The next day he had recovered some of the sight but two days later he had a massive stroke which took his right side. He was in hospital for two and a half weeks where he received wonderful treatment. He is making very good progress but, unfortunately, the memory and sight are still affected and he is unable to drive. This makes life difficult and he cannot get to shows on his own.

Among other shows which D.C. Site Services worked at were Rockness, Taste, the Hyde Park Shows including the Mandela Birthday Celebrations, Lovebox, Wakestock, T in the Park, Connect and the shows for Festival Republic including Glastonbury, Latitude, Reading and Leeds. There were numerous other small shows as well.

Friends, family and staff really rallied during the summer and all our commitments were fulfilled.  Dick and I went to Leeds Festival and I worked at Proms in the Park.

We would like to thank everyone for their hard work and dedication during this difficult year for us.

At the moment we do not know what the future holds but we hope that we will be seeing you all in 2009.

Wishing you all a Very Merry Christmas and a Happy New Year - Dick & Janet."
